RWD aircraft are known mostly for the records in 1930s. The modified RWD5 was used for the first transatlantic flight of a light airplane up to 450kg in 1933 (Skarżyński), RWD6 and RWD9 were the winners of Challenge in 1932 (Żwirko, Wigura) and 1934 (Bajan, Pokrzywka). RWD4 was actually the last one with that weird layout neglecting the front sight. And it marked the Polish debut in Challenge in 1930 ranking 32nd. Quite a history of Polish input into international aviation history.

Some tedious work apparently finished. The fuselage seams filled. Also the model had a surprising feature of recessed panel lines along all the ribs on the linen covered surfaces, not the best way of showing those imho - so I duly filled them and it seems that after a couple of filling/sanding sessions the result is acceptable for airbrushing. And two nasty air bubbles in the wheels are also successfully removed.
